Ratanda Regina celebrates 100th birthday

Not only has Regina Mpolokeng Mofokeng walked this earth for 100 years, but she also survived five of her eight siblings.

Born in Lesotho on 22 May 1918. Ratanda Regina came to live in South Africa with her brothers in 1935 when she was 17 years old. At the age of 22 she was in a customary marriage, which by definition is one that is negotiated, celebrated or concluded according to any of the systems of indigenous African customary law which exist in South Africa.

Eight children were born from the marriage and to keep food on the table, Regina earned a living as a domestic worker.

She is blessed with 23 grandchildren and has many great grandchildren. Regina was recently diagnosed with diabetes which restricts her from moving around freely.

According to her granddaughter Amelia, she spends most of her time in bed, but she is otherwise healthy.
